Hey there! Let's talk about Tharja, one of the more unique characters you'll meet in Fire Emblem: Awakening. She's a Plegian dark mage, and honestly, she's got a bit of a creepy vibe, always chanting hexes and keeping to herself. But here's the kicker: she's got a major unhealthy obsession with your Avatar. Think of her as the one with the darkest thoughts in the group, which definitely makes her stand out!
When it comes to her potential classes, Tharja can grow into a few different roles. She starts as a Dark Mage and can promote into a Sorcerer or a Dark Knight. She also has the option to branch out into an Archer, eventually becoming a Sniper or a Bow Knight. This flexibility means you can tailor her to your playstyle.
Tharja can form support relationships with a few characters. She'll have an A-rank support with Nowi, and can achieve an S-rank support with several male characters, including Kellam, Donnel, Frederick, Gaius, Gregor, Henry, Libra, Ricken, Lon’qu, Stahl, Vaike, and Virion. If you're aiming for a specific paired ending or want to see unique dialogue, keep these supports in mind!
She also has a daughter, Noire, who can join your team if you pair Tharja with your Avatar. Noire inherits some of Tharja's traits and can be a powerful unit in her own right.
Looking at her growth rates, Tharja is a magic-focused unit. She has a 'C' rank in HP, Strength, Luck, and Defense, but shines with 'B' ranks in Magic and Speed. Her Skill and Resistance are a bit lower, with 'D' ranks. This means she'll naturally get stronger with magic and faster as she levels up, making her great for dishing out damage from a distance, but you'll want to protect her from magic attacks.
